They're perfectly legal for imports.

However cars designed for sale in Australia must conform with the ADRs (which include amber indicators). But there is a bit of a hole in it that allows American vehicles to be used in Aus that can keep the red tail lights.

So bottom line is that no, you're not allowed to fit them to an Australian vehicle, but you can have them on your SSS Jap import. That's the technicality - But I wouldn't let it stop you as the difference between the 1600s of different origins are very little (so it is hard to tell whether it is imported or not).
